adj
Good as a remedy against disease of the spleen.
Acting against ill humor, associated with the spleen.
His intentions were apparently as antisplenetic as Sterne's, though his book turned out to be more genial than mirthful, and therefore decidedly less efficacious in fighting the spleen.
